Squirrel Infested Chimney

We have a fireplace insert in our front room. Last week we began to hear what appeared to be a squirrel in the chimney above the wood stove. It's not the first time a squirrel has gotten in there. In the past I just lit a fire and either they died in there or they were smoked out. Anyway, I lit a fire Saturday morning in hopes to get rid of the squirrel. But later that evening we hear him going crazy inside the chimney again. Of course the cats are freaking out, just standing guard in front of the wood stove. So the next morning I decide to pull the stove out and see if the squirrel will come out. Sure enough after I have about a 4 inch gap out comes this little baby squirrel. I gather him up in a basket and put him outside. About 5 minutes later another one comes out. Know we have 2 and we can here another still in there. The last one didn't come out so I pushed the stove back in for the evening.
Today when I got home the cats were again standing guard. I pulled the stove out and went outside to do some yard work when I came in a couple hours later the cat was chasing the squirrel around the house. I finally managed to shoe it outside but it is still hanging around. I've scheduled the chimney guy to come by next week and repair the chimney cap so we can keep animals out.
